New Travel Rules — COVID-19 Tests for Overseas Travel to U.S.

There are now new travel rules in place. Anyone flying to the United States from overseas — and that also includes Americans, must show a valid negative COVID-19 test within 72 hours before taking their flight, or they won’t be allowed entry into America.

A number of hotels around the world, ranging from the Turks and Caicos in the Caribbean to Turkey to Mexico, have pivoted quickly and are now offering guests those required COVID-19 PCR tests so that they can return home on schedule.

And Palace Resorts and Le Blanc Resorts in Mexico went a step further. They are now offering guests a free COVID-19 PCR test if they’re traveling to the U.S.

If a guest tests positive, the hotel will then cover the total cost of quarantine (along with a companion for up to 14 days, should both guests test positive).

This certainly takes the worry out of traveling there in the first place, and more hotels around the world are expected to follow suit.
